    A man's handed himself in and been charged over an alleged machete attack near a Sikh Temple in Auckland's Takanini last night


    The male victim was attacked about 5pm at a sports complex near the temple - and a second person was hurt trying to intervene.

    Supreme Sikh Society spokesman Daljit Singh alleges the attacker - with no links to the Temple - arrived with a machete in his bag.

    Police say the two knew each other - and they're not treating it as a hate-motivated crime.

    A 33-year-old's been charged with threats to kill and assault with a weapon.
